SAF Sues Over Michigan Agency’s Gun Regulations for Foster Parents

July 17, 2017 By Dave Workman

The Second Amendment Foundation has filed a lawsuit in federal district court in Michigan, challenging that state’s regulations on firearms ownership and use for anyone seeking to become a foster parent. The lawsuit was filed in U.S. District Court for the Western District of Michigan against Nick Lyon “in his official capacity as director of […]
